According to a report from PWInsider, former three-time Ring of Honor World Champion Adam Cole has signed a deal with WWE and will be making his debut soon.

PWInsider had the initial report and Pro Wrestling Sheet later confirmed that Cole has signed a deal with WWE and is set to make his debut soon. PWInsider also reported that Cole will report to the WWE Performance Center in Orlando to begin training prior to working in NXT.

Ever since Cole was kicked out of the Bullet Club this summer by Kenny Omega — during the debut of Marty Scurll in BC — the rumors were hotter than a stove about Cole coming to WWE at some point shortly after.

There had been no official reports on Cole’s future plans, but the writing was on the wall for Cole to make the move, especially with other Ring of Honor names like Kyle O’Reilly and Bobby Fish already in NXT.

With Cole in the picture, it gives NXT a huge jolt in the arm moving forward past Brooklyn. As strong as the brand has been in recent years, it’s been lacking some real star power in Orlando with a departure list that includes Kevin Owens, Finn Balor, Shinsuke Nakamura, The Revival and each of the Four Horsewomen.

Cole may not be the biggest performer, but he’s one of the best you’ll see in WWE. He’s a fantastic talker and would be one of the absolute best in the company upon his official arrival. He’s the only three-time ROH Champion in history and for good reason.
